Colder Products Company (CPC) is the leading provider of quick disconnect couplings, fittings and connectors for plastic tubing. At CPC, we believe that fluid handling should be safe and easy. We engineer our connection solutions to improve the overall functionality and design of equipment and processes for the life sciences, industrial, and chemical handling markets. Special features of our products include precise hose barbs for superior grip, built-in shutoff valves for preventing spills, and easy-to-use, push-button thumb latches for quick connecting and disconnecting. CPC is a Dover company based in St. Paul with global offices and operations in Europe and Asia.
